The Ultimate Guide to Butterfly Valves: Applications, Types, and Benefits

Butterfly valves are essential components in various industrial applications, offering reliable and efficient flow control solutions. From regulating the flow of liquids and gases to isolating and diverting streams, butterfly valves play a crucial role in ensuring the smooth operation of pipelines and systems. In this comprehensive guide, we will explore everything you need to know about butterfly valves, including their applications, types, and benefits.

One of the key advantages of butterfly valves is their versatility in a wide range of applications. These valves are commonly used in industries such as oil and gas, water treatment, chemical processing, HVAC systems, and more. Whether you need to control the flow of water, steam, air, or corrosive chemicals, butterfly valves offer a reliable and cost-effective solution.

There are several types of butterfly valves available, including wafer, lug, and flanged butterfly valves. Each type has its unique design and features, making them suitable for different applications and operating conditions. For example, wafer butterfly valves are lightweight and easy to install between flanges, while lug butterfly valves provide added stability and support in high-pressure applications.

Butterfly valves offer several benefits compared to other types of valves, such as ball valves or gate valves. One of the main advantages is their quick and easy operation, allowing for fast opening and closing with a simple quarter-turn of the handle or actuator. This makes butterfly valves ideal for applications where rapid flow control is required.

Additionally, butterfly valves are known for their compact design and low-pressure drop, minimizing energy consumption and reducing operating costs. Their simple construction also results in easy maintenance and long-term reliability, making them a preferred choice for many industries.
